当前时区 GMT+8, 现在时间是 2008-8-30 05:52 游客: 注册 登录 仅登录论坛 | 搜索 帮助


标题: Kernel 2.6.15.3升级到2.6.24.3(ML2.0)
test2002
中级会员
Rank: 3Rank: 3


UID 117350
精华 0
积分 717
帖子 301
阅读权限 30
注册 2004-4-21
来自 China.gif
状态 离线
发表于 2008-3-21 22:21  资料  短消息  加为好友 
Kernel 2.6.15.3升级到2.6.24.3(ML2.0)

成功的将kernel从有漏洞的2.6.15.3升级到2.6.24.3,记录如下:
1. 下载linux-2.6.24.3.tar.bz2。
2. 解压到/usr/src/linux-2.6.24.3
3.执行make xconfig,打开/lib/modules/2.6.15.3/build/.config,保持configure不变,我在这儿打开了ntfs写开关。还打开了硬盘的DMA什么的,没有记住。
4. make 编译
5.make modules_install 安装模块
6.make install 安装内核心引导
7.到/boot看一看。有没有initrd-2.6.24.3.img,vmlinuz-2.6.24.3,再检查一下grub.conf
8.reboot使用2.6.24.3核心。
感觉比以前硬盘反应快了许多。但是Ntfs硬盘还是不能写,是不是fuse没有安装的缘故,研究中。

顶部
jiangtao9999
超级版主

到此一游


UID 9578
精华 3
积分 44104
帖子 29897
阅读权限 245
注册 2002-12-26
来自 公社光棍帮总坛
状态 离线
发表于 2008-3-21 23:14  资料  主页 短消息  加为好友  添加 jiangtao9999 为MSN好友 通过MSN和 jiangtao9999 交谈


QUOTE:
我在这儿打开了ntfs写开关

不要数据请直接格式化,不要用内核的 ntfs 写支持来清理数据





梦想是那么的远,又是那么的近………… <--只能剩下这句祈祷了
我要签名图!!!!!!
顶部
test2002
中级会员
Rank: 3Rank: 3


UID 117350
精华 0
积分 717
帖子 301
阅读权限 30
注册 2004-4-21
来自 China.gif
状态 离线
发表于 2008-3-22 20:50  资料  短消息  加为好友 


QUOTE:
原帖由 jiangtao9999 于 2008-3-21 23:14 发表

不要数据请直接格式化,不要用内核的 ntfs 写支持来清理数据

这个注意到了。有空再make一下。

顶部
atang520 (™)
高级会员
Rank: 4
┊ωǒ ﹀ァ.


UID 188072
精华 4
积分 1255
帖子 630
阅读权限 50
注册 2005-4-5
来自 GuangDong
状态 离线
发表于 2008-3-22 23:19  资料  短消息  加为好友 
我的也是ML2.0,我能否用2.6.15.3 的配置文件编译 Kernel 2.6.24.3?顺便问一下编译内核需要多长时间?我的机器:c1.7,256M

[ 本帖最后由 atang520 于 2008-3-22 23:55 编辑 ]





顶部
test2002
中级会员
Rank: 3Rank: 3


UID 117350
精华 0
积分 717
帖子 301
阅读权限 30
注册 2004-4-21
来自 China.gif
状态 离线
发表于 2008-3-23 09:20  资料  短消息  加为好友 
/lib/modules/2.6.15.3/build/.config这个就是原来的配置文件,昨天我重新选了一下,cpu直接选了PIII,DMA读写好像原来没有打开。11点开始make,早上起来已经完成了,抱歉不知道make一下几个小时,我的机器是P3 -750MHz (1G的CPU用在BX的板子上), 384M。

感觉比昨天的还要快一些,按说针对CPU的优化,只能快1%-3%,我都明显地感觉到了,就不止3%了。

顶部
atang520 (™)
高级会员
Rank: 4
┊ωǒ ﹀ァ.


UID 188072
精华 4
积分 1255
帖子 630
阅读权限 50
注册 2005-4-5
来自 GuangDong
状态 离线
发表于 2008-3-23 13:11  资料  短消息  加为好友 
是否需要打补丁?





顶部
test2002
中级会员
Rank: 3Rank: 3


UID 117350
精华 0
积分 717
帖子 301
阅读权限 30
注册 2004-4-21
来自 China.gif
状态 离线
发表于 2008-3-23 19:19  资料  短消息  加为好友 
应该已经是最新的了。

顶部
atang520 (™)
高级会员
Rank: 4
┊ωǒ ﹀ァ.


UID 188072
精华 4
积分 1255
帖子 630
阅读权限 50
注册 2005-4-5
来自 GuangDong
状态 离线
发表于 2008-4-1 15:55  资料  短消息  加为好友 


QUOTE:
原帖由 test2002 于 2008-3-23 19:19 发表
应该已经是最新的了。

我说的是公社里的内核补丁

在公社下了个 kernel-smp-2.6.22.12-1mgc.src.rpm,解压,想为kernel-2.6.24.3打上里面的一些 patch,但打补丁时出现错误,仔细比较源代码及 patch,发现这些 patch比较旧,应用不了最新的源代码...





顶部
sejishikong
管理员



UID 73
精华 16
积分 14578
帖子 6623
阅读权限 255
注册 2002-6-22
来自 China
状态 离线
发表于 2008-4-1 16:11  资料  主页 短消息  加为好友  添加 sejishikong 为MSN好友 通过MSN和 sejishikong 交谈 QQ
呵呵,现在ml的内核是没打过补丁的.
beta2后考虑增加一些比较有用的补丁.

顶部
test2002
中级会员
Rank: 3Rank: 3


UID 117350
精华 0
积分 717
帖子 301
阅读权限 30
注册 2004-4-21
来自 China.gif
状态 离线
发表于 2008-4-3 09:20  资料  短消息  加为好友 


QUOTE:
原帖由 atang520 于 2008-4-1 15:55 发表


我说的是公社里的内核补丁

在公社下了个 kernel-smp-2.6.22.12-1mgc.src.rpm,解压,想为kernel-2.6.24.3打上里面的一些 patch,但打补丁时出现错误,仔细比较源代码及 patch,发现这些 patch ...

现在是2.6.24.4了,为何要大smp补丁,难道是多CPU的?

顶部
sejishikong
管理员



UID 73
精华 16
积分 14578
帖子 6623
阅读权限 255
注册 2002-6-22
来自 China
状态 离线
发表于 2008-4-3 10:52  资料  主页 短消息  加为好友  添加 sejishikong 为MSN好友 通过MSN和 sejishikong 交谈 QQ
smp不是补丁,只是配置,考虑到双核越来越多,所以打开了smp,我的机器基本都是单核的,测试下来基本没有影响.

顶部
 


Powered by Discuz! 5.5.0  © 2001-2007 Comsenz Inc.
清除 Cookies - 联系我们 - 中国Linux公社 - WAP